Fig. 1. Holotype and only known specimen of the metatherian mammal Archaeonothos henkgodthelpi gen. et sp. nov. (QM F53825; M2 or M3) from the early Eocene Tingamarra Fauna, southeastern Queensland, Australia; in occlusal (A) and lingual (B) views. Both SEM micrographs.
